How to Complete an American Red Cross Volunteer Application Form

Completing an American Red Cross volunteer application form has become much easier in the last few years, thanks to the Internet. Whether you choose to apply in person at a local chapter of the American Red Cross or log on to their official website, you can start donating your time to this worthy cause within a few days.

Instructions

  1. Apply to the American Red Cross

    • 1

      Find a local chapter of the American Red Cross that is convenient to you and ask to complete the volunteer application form.

    • 2

      Complete the VolunteerMatch form, which will ask you how much time you will be able to donate to the American Red Cross, what special skills you may have that can help the organization (such as medical training or teaching credentials) and the location in which you want to work. In addition, you will be asked if you prefer to work with children, people over the age of 55 or other specific demographic groups.

    • 3

      Check out the listings for the volunteer positions available with the American Red Cross. These include Blood Donor Recruiter, Board Member, Disaster Services Clerk, HIV/AIDS Mentor, Safety Instructor, International Tracing Service Clerk and many more. In all, there are 30 positions available for volunteers in the American Red Cross, and members of the local chapter can help you find the position that is right for you based on your skills.

    • 4

      Ask about training programs offered by the American Red Cross that can help you to be a more specialized volunteer. For instance, you can be trained in how to use a computer, how to perform CPR and how to teach a swimming class to the elderly. You can specify all of this when you complete your volunteer application form.

    • 5

      Use the official website of the American Red Cross to fill out the VolunteerMatch application form online (see Resources below). You will them be contacted by phone or email by a local Red Cross chapter with a list of volunteer position for which you may be qualified.

    • 6

      Utilize the VolunteerMatch data base to find positions based upon location. You can find the right position by customizing your search based on ZIP code, state or geographical region.
